Best Computer Science Bachelor's Degree Programs In Madison, Alabama 2025

By ComputerScienceBachelorsDegree Editorial Team
Published January 15, 2025
5 min readUpdated February 28, 2025

Exploring Computer Science Degree Programs In Madison, Alabama

Computer Science Bachelor Degree Program schools in Madison, Alabama, offer excellent educational opportunities for aspiring tech professionals. Located adjacent to Huntsville, known for its dynamic technology sector, Madison benefits from a blend of urban resources and a small-town atmosphere. This combination creates a conducive environment for both learning and personal growth.

Students can access top-tier faculty, modern facilities, and a curriculum designed to meet industry demands. The proximity to key tech firms and defense contractors opens doors to internships and job opportunities. Additionally, Madison's cost of living is relatively lower than other regions, making it an attractive location for students pursuing a degree without incurring substantial debt.

Madison is home to several esteemed institutions, each providing a robust Computer Science curriculum. Degree programs often cover essential topics such as programming, algorithms, data structures, machine learning, and network security. A strong focus on practical experience equips students with the skills required to excel in the tech industry, ensuring a well-rounded education.

Madison is not just a place of learning but also offers a supportive community. The city hosts various tech meetups, hackathons, and networking events, fostering an environment where students can gain insights from industry professionals. Moreover, the university collaborations with local businesses aid in creating a smooth transition from academics to the workforce.

Overall, choosing to study Computer Science in Madison positions students at the forefront of technology and innovation, making it a compelling option for those looking to make their mark in the field.

Best Computer Science Bachelor's Degree Programs Near Madison, Alabama

Below are the top ranked computer science bachelor's degree programs in the surrounding areas of Madison, Alabama

Address: 2101 West End Avenue, Nashville,Tennessee, Davidson County, 37240
In-State Tuition: $61,618
Out-of-State Tuition: $61,618
Full-time Enrollment: 13,456
Graduation Rate: 93%
Admission Rate: 6%
Programs Offered: 1
Address: 1301 East Main Street, Murfreesboro,Tennessee, Rutherford County, 37132
Address: 7000 Adventist Blvd NW, Huntsville,Alabama, Madison County, 35896

Common Admission Requirements For Computer Science Degree ProgramsIn Madison, Alabama

Applying for a Computer Science Bachelor’s degree in Madison, Alabama typically involves meeting a few standard admission requirements across various schools. While these may vary by institution, the following general criteria are prevalent:

Cost & Financial Aid Options For Computer Science Degree Programs In Madison, Alabama

Studying computer science in Madison, Alabama, comes with associated costs, including tuition, fees, and living expenses. Here’s a closer look at these expenditures along with financial aid options:

Frequently Asked Questions (FAQs) About Computer Science Degree Programs In Madison, Alabama

  1. What are the best schools for a Computer Science degree in Madison, Alabama?

    • Local institutions offering excellent programs include Auburn University and the University of Alabama in Huntsville.
  2. What is the average tuition for a Computer Science degree in Madison?

    • Tuition typically ranges from $9,000 to $30,000 annually, depending on in-state or out-of-state status.
  3. Are there online Computer Science programs available?

    • Yes, many schools offer online or hybrid programs to accommodate different learning preferences.
  4. Is financial aid available for Computer Science students?

    • Yes, students can apply for federal aid, state scholarships, institutional grants, and private scholarships.
  5. What skills will I gain from a Computer Science program?

    • You will learn programming, software development, algorithms, data analysis, and cybersecurity.
  6. Are internships required in Computer Science programs?

    • While not mandatory, internships are highly encouraged to gain practical experience and enhance job prospects.
  7. How soon can I find a job after graduation?

    • Graduates often find job opportunities within a few months, especially in tech-heavy regions like Madison.
  8. What industries are growing in Madison for computer science professionals?

    • Technology, government/defense, healthcare, and finance sectors are actively hiring computer science graduates.
  9. Can I specialize in a specific area of computer science?

    • Yes, many programs offer concentrations in areas like cybersecurity, artificial intelligence, or software engineering.
  10. What is the typical class size for Computer Science programs?

    • Class sizes usually range from 20 to 40 students, allowing for personalized instruction and interaction with professors.